The cheapest way to get from Coconino National Forest to Phoenix is to drive which costs $17 - $25 and takes 1h 35m.
The fastest way to get from Coconino National Forest to Phoenix is to drive which takes 1h 35m and costs $17 - $25.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Sedona(ARCO) and arriving at Phoenix Bus Station station. Services depart once da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 45m.
The distance between Coconino National Forest and Phoenix is 121 miles. The road distance is 94.8 miles.
The best way to get from Coconino National Forest to Phoenix without a car is to bus which takes 2h 11m and costs $75 - $120.
It takes approximately 2h 11m to get from Coconino National Forest to Phoenix, including transfers.
Coconino National Forest to Phoenix bus services, operated by Greyhound-us, depart from Sedona(ARCO) station.
Coconino National Forest to Phoenix bus services, operated by Greyhound-us, arrive at Phoenix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Coconino National Forest to Phoenix is 95 miles. It takes approximately 1h 35m to drive from Coconino National Forest to Phoenix.
